About the Job
Description: Supervises 2 office employees. Performs general accounting clerical duties in the preparation, processing and maintenance of credit, collections, billing records, accounts payable and payroll. Supervises the day-to-day office functions and administrative operations including office equipment systems, office supply purchasing, facility management and filing management to ensure maximum operating efficiency and productivity.
Responsibilities: · Data entry all payments for accounts receivable, reviews for any adjustments and does billing · Data enters all sales and change orders for radio stations · Prepares daily program logs, continuity scheduling and reconciliation reports · Greets guests, answers telephones, routes calls, records messages, schedules appointments, sorts and distributes incoming mail, prepares outgoing mail. · Coordinates the organizational calendar, staff meetings and general reception. Coordinates logistics for selected conferences and special meetings. · Assist with human resources related functions such as workers compensation claims and benefit administration. · Arranges for building and grounds maintenance and janitorial services · Assists with special projects
Requirements: · Associates Degree in Business Administration, Accounting, Finance or related field: or equivalent level of experience. · Computer literacy in MS Office Package (Word, Excel, Outlook) programs · Speed in typing and ten-key skills · Self Starter, embraces challenging situations and well organized · Problem-solving ability and skill in prioritizing · Attention to detail, time management skills and ability to handle crucial situations decisively and efficiently. · Ability to multi-task and handle pressures and deadlines · Ability to interact with management and staff at all levels · Excellent verbal and written communication skills ·
